Output 81cad1f3cfc0d9f5fdd186a2a3819642bdbb281aec5a1fd08eb57ca0430cb39a:131

value
331089
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 50ea0a805f9cc749d3f868fc2dd6a9e8d894931da53a30665bfd9c9c22db7648
address
tb1p2r4q4qzlnnr5n5lcdr7zm44farvffyca55arqejmlkwfcgkmweyqfhcmv2
transaction
81cad1f3cfc0d9f5fdd186a2a3819642bdbb281aec5a1fd08eb57ca0430cb39a
confirmations
17379
spent
false

2 Sat Ranges